Transaction 6493639e11e122b6771f0412386722e4c178b9dd1d22f68c2da5a46d1ddae744

2 Input
2 Outputs
  • 6493639e11e122b6771f0412386722e4c178b9dd1d22f68c2da5a46d1ddae744:0
  • value  31777300
    address  3B3KbGSDZBB17HpGkGun6dbHYm6oRTz5sy
  • 6493639e11e122b6771f0412386722e4c178b9dd1d22f68c2da5a46d1ddae744:1
  • value  1736234
    address  3EHsHfugpRE7rBmWGfggJkkPYzzkcKYPv7